Description

MS. vol. of music, comprising sundry psalms, anthems for Whit Sunday etc.

Early 19 cent. (before 1830)?

Bound in old calf.

Oblong sm. fo. 51ff.

(First f. cut out)

(i.e. originally 52)

Last 25ff. blank.
